What Al Qurayyah brides should know
Al Qurayyah’s layout—low-rise villas, mid-rise apartments, and a few newer compounds—means bridal makeup logistics can vary. If you’re in a villa, parking is rarely an issue, but artists may need to carry equipment from the street to your door, especially in older areas where driveways are narrow. For high-rise apartments, check if the building has service elevators or time restrictions for vendor access. The area’s proximity to the wadi also means some streets can get dusty, so plan to keep windows closed during the session if you’re near unpaved roads. And while power outages are rare, it’s worth having a backup plan for lighting if you’re in an older building.
Fujairah’s climate plays a role in bridal makeup prep. The dry air can make skin feel tight, so many local brides opt for hydrating primers or setting sprays to lock in moisture. If you’re getting married in summer, schedule the session for early morning to avoid midday humidity, which can cause makeup to slide. Some Al Qurayyah brides also request waterproof formulas as a precaution, given the area’s occasional rain showers. And if you’re hosting a beach wedding, ask your artist about long-wear products that can withstand wind and sand.
frequently asked questions
How far in advance should I book bridal makeup in Al Qurayyah?
Most brides book 4-6 weeks ahead, especially for weekend weddings. Fujairah’s wedding season (October to April) fills up quickly, so earlier is better for popular artists.
Do artists bring their own chairs and mirrors?
Yes, licensed bridal makeup artists arrive with professional kits, including adjustable chairs, mirrors, and lighting. You just need to provide a clean, well-lit space.

What if I have sensitive skin or allergies?
Discuss this during the trial. Most artists use hypoallergenic products and can adjust their kit based on your needs. Patch tests are recommended for first-time clients.
